Mission
To strengthen the network of HHS providers, funders, and beneficiaries in East King County and contribute to building a more resilient, aligned, and effective human services system in our community.
Eastside Human Services Forum is a nonprofit organization categorized as Small Public Charity based in Kirkland, WA. Its most recent IRS filing (2022) reports revenue of $56K, expenses of $77K, total assets of $32K. |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2022 | $56K | $77K | $32K |
| 2020 | $99K | $91K | $65K |
| 2019 | $96K | $82K | $57K |
| 2018 | $82K | $77K | $43K |
| 2017 | $68K | $65K | $38K |
Between 2017 and 2022, reported annual revenue declined from $68K to $56K (-17%), with total assets most recently reported at $32K.
